With a reliable bug zapper racket, you may dispatch flying insects at shut range. Most rackets are durable and designed to kill on contact. This makes them convenient for Zap Zone Defender Review dealing with small pest issues across the house. Plus, zapper rackets don’t often depend on chemicals to work. This makes them a safer, in-house answer to pest control than other choices. Typically represented as volts, shock strength impacts how well a bug zapper racket kills insects. Most rackets have a voltage ranging from 500 to 3,000, Zap Zone Defender but probably the most reliable fashions have not less than 2,000 volts. Should you want a stronger insect killer or plan to focus on multiple pests at once, consider getting a bug zapper that goes outside. Be careful with rackets which have a better voltage as they can run scorching with common use. In the event you notice yours is starting to overheat, turn it off and take it outside so it may well cool down.



Alternatively, select a racket with an outer layer to keep from accidentally shocking your fingers. With a protective layer: Some have a mesh outer layer that keeps the consumer from making direct contact with the electric grid. This is particularly useful for those with small youngsters, who may injure themselves by using the racket. The draw back is that the mesh also can keep larger insects from reaching the grid, making the racket much less effective. With no protective layer: Others don’t have the added mesh layer. While this is sweet for coping with insects of all sizes, it doesn’t provide protection from getting shocked. As the name implies, most bug rackets appear like normal rackets, reminiscent of those used for tennis. Handle: That is often between 7 and 12 inches lengthy. Some handles have an ergonomic design or nonslip grip for Zap Zone Defender Review simple use. Head: The head size is determined by the racket, Defender by Zap Zone with some fashions being bigger than others. A larger head means extra surface area for killing pests with out needing to be precise.



A smaller head requires extra accuracy when utilizing the racket. Electric grid: This is commonly product of wires, whereas the pinnacle and handle include exhausting plastic. On its own, the grid is considerably durable, however it can get damaged if you employ the racket like a conventional flyswatter. Most bug zapper rackets rely on lithium or AA batteries. These require substitute every couple of years. Some rackets include extra batteries, while others require a separate purchase. Some rackets come with a built-in rechargeable battery. These rackets often price extra upfront, but they'll last a long time and don’t require additional batteries later. Rackets that come with a rechargeable battery additionally typically have a charging station. Active light or energy gentle: Zap Zone Defender Experience Generally small and purple, this mild indicates when the electric grid is energetic. This could keep you from leaving it on when not in use. Special attracting gentle: Some rackets have an ultraviolet or LED mild that lures flying insects.



Activate grid button: The electric grid won’t activate until you press a particular button on the handle or below the pinnacle. Some rackets necessitate holding the button, whereas others don't.
